
BCN3DSigma- Bowden entry extruder + Cone
thingiverse
I had some faulty filaments that broke into tiny strands inside the Bowden tube leading to the extruder. I decided to bypass the inner Bowden tube by feeding the extruder directly. After testing several prints, it's working amazingly well! To get this setup right, I added a cone to the "BCN3DSigma - Bowden entry extruder" part and reattached it with the old screw. This new method is much simpler and faster now, reducing friction and saving time on cleaning and filament replacement errors - essentially, it's as close as I can get to a direct feed setup.
